About N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ide
N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ide (PubChem CID 90554814) has the molecular formula C17H22F3NO2S
and a molecular weight of 361.43 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ide.

What is the SMILES notation for N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ide?
The canonical SMILES for N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ide is O=C(N(CC(F)(F)F)C1CCOCC1)C1(c2cccs2)CCCC1.
What is the InChIKey of N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ide?
The InChIKey is KAAUZTVGTASHCZ-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C17H22F3NO2S/c18-17(19,20)12-21(13-5-9-23-10-6-13)15(22)16(7-1-2-8-16)14-4-3-11-24-14/h3-4,11,13H,1-2,5-10,12H2.
What are the key properties of N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ide?
N-(oxan-4-yl)-1-thiophen-2-yl-N-(2,2,2-trifluoroethyl)cyclopentane-1-carboxamide has a molecular weight of 361.43 g/mol, XLogP of 4.13, 4 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
